Siemens dishwasher leaking water onto the floor?
I've got a Siemens dishwasher that's just over a year old and it leaks water out onto the kitchen floor part way through the cycle. What should I check first?
1 Answer
If it’s leaking part way through the wash, the first aim is to work out whether it’s overflowing, splashing out, or leaking from a hose/seal underneath. On a Siemens of this age, start with the simple external checks first.
1. **Check the door seal and lower door area** Look for splits, distortion, food debris or grease on the main door seal. Also check the **bottom edge of the door** and the inner lip for damage or heavy build-up. A poor seal can let water escape once the wash pressure increases.
2. **Inspect the spray arms** Remove and check both spray arms for cracks, blocked jets, or if one is loose. A split spray arm can fire water directly at the door and cause leaking onto the floor part way through the cycle.
3. **Check loading** Make sure nothing tall is stopping the spray arm rotating or deflecting water toward the door. Trays, baking sheets and large pans are common causes.
4. **Look at the filters and sump area** Clean the filters thoroughly and check for debris around them. Poor draining or restricted circulation can sometimes contribute to odd leak behaviour.
5. **Run a short cycle and watch carefully** If safe to do so, observe exactly **where** the water appears first: from under the door, one front corner, or from underneath. That helps narrow it down to a seal, spray issue, or internal hose/pump leak.
6. **If the leak is from underneath** Isolate the appliance from the mains before removing any panels or inspecting internal parts. Then check hoses, hose clips, the sump/pump area and inlet valve for drips. If water has collected in the base tray, there may be an internal leak triggering it.
Because it’s only just over a year old, I’d also check whether it’s still covered by the retailer or Siemens warranty. If the leak is internal, or any mains-related work is needed, it’s best handled by a qualified engineer.
